“…These revelations open up the prospect of a closer engagement between mainstream and normative IR, two communities that have hitherto been quite skeptical of one another’s respective approaches. Indeed, Carr’s concern with fairness overlaps with the interests of Rawlsians in IR and the conception of justice as fairness (Doyle, 2015; Eckert, 2015; Rawls, 1971; Risse, 2016; Tong, 2017; Williams, 2014), whereas Wendt’s project for global peace is also a concern of cosmopolitans (Brown, 2012a; Hayden, 2013; Hibbert, 2013; McManus, 2013; Vernon, 2013). This may enable closer engagement between these diverse communities that rarely speak to one another and strengthen the disciplinary research on ethics as a result.…”
